Mohanlal's 'Malaikottai Vaaliban' gets a release date, check out

18 Sep 2023

Lijo Jose Pellissery has directed the movie.Sharing the update, Mohanlal took to X and wrote, "The countdown has begun! Vaaliban is arriving in theatres worldwide on 25th January 2024! #VaalibanOnJan25 #MalaikottaiVaaliban."The countdown has begun!Vaaliban is arriving in theatres worldwide on 25th January 2024!#VaalibanOnJan25#MalaikottaiVaaliban@mrinvicible@shibu_babyjohn@achubabyjohn@mesonalee@danishsait#johnandmarycreative#maxlab@VIKME@sidakumar@YoodleeFilms@saregamasouth Mohanlal (@Mohanlal) September 18, 2023He also talked about his experience working with Lijo."To work with Lijo Jose Pellissery has been very enriching as his cinematic approach is totally unique. His films stand apart not just for their technical finesse but also their themes and this project is no different. I hope, together we will be able to live up to the expectations of the audience," Mohanlal shared.'Malaikottai Vaaliban'Malaikottai Vaaliban is created under Yoodlee Films. The film is written by PS Rafeeque. Madhu Neelakandan helms the cinematography and the music is by Prashanth Pillai. It is produced by Shibu Baby John, Achu Baby John, Kochumon Century, Jacob Babu, Vikram Mehra and Siddharth Anand Kumar.

Jallikattu out of Oscars 2021 race; Karishma Dubes short film Bittu makes to top 10

10 Feb 2021

On Wednesday, after the 93rd Oscars shortlists of nine categories were announced, India officially got out of the race for the Best International Feature Film. The Malayalam film Jallikattu directed by Lijo Jose Pellissery was India's official entry for the Oscars from the said category. However, on the bright side, Karishma Dev Dube's directorial Bittu has made it to the Live Action Short Film shortlist.The Academy on Wednesday morning announced the shortlist for the following categories: International Feature Film, Documentary, Original Score, Original Song, Makeup and Hairstyling, Visual Effects, Live-Action Short Film, Documentary Short Subject, and Animated Short Film. The shortlisted films will compete for the nominations.The Malayalam film Jallikattu was highly appreciated in India but failed to make it to the longer shortlist of fifteen films that will compete to make it for the nominations. It is based on the short story named Maoist by Hareesh. The film stars Antony Varghese, Chemban Vinod Jose, Sabumon Abdusamad and Santhy Balachandran. Films from 93 countries were eligible in the category, the most in Oscars history.Talking about Bittu, the film directed by Karishma Dev Dube is among the top 10 short films that made it to the next level of Oscars 2021. The film tells the tale of a heartwarming friendship between two school-going friends and is based on a true story.
